ANNIE GET YOUR GUN
FRIDAY, JANUARY 29 | 8 PM
SATURDAY, JANUARY 30 | 8 PM
SUNDAY, JANUARY 31 | 2 PM
JAMES R. ARMSTRONG THEATRE
3330 CIVIC CENTER DRIVE
The Aerospace Players present "Annie Get Your Gun," their first musical of the year. The story is a fun, fictionalized tale of the Wild West, loosely based on the life of Annie Oakley. Annie, the best shot around, supports her family by selling the game she hunts. One day she's discovered by Buffalo Bill who convinces her to join his traveling show as a sharpshooter. MEET THE AUTHOR OF 'FORBIDDEN CITY, USA'
SATURDAY, JANUARY 30 | 2 PM
KATY GEISSERT CIVIC CENTER LIBRARY
3301 TORRANCE BLVD.
Arthur Dong will pay a special visit to the Civic Center Library to discuss his book Forbidden City, USA. The book, winner of the American Book Award in 2015, details the magic and glamour of the Chinese American nightclub scene in San Francisco during World War II. Chapters include previously unpublished personal stories along with more than 400 stunning images. Meet an Award Winning Author...
'VANYA AND SONIA AND MASHA AND SPIKE'
WEEKENDS NOW THROUGH FEBRUARY 14
TORRANCE THEATRE COMPANY
1316 CABRILLO AVENUE
Torrance Theatre Company presents another weekend of its winter production of the Tony winning comedy, "Vanya and Sonia and Masha and Spike." Middle-aged siblings Vanya and Sonia share a home in Pennsylvania where they bicker and complain about the circumstances of their lives. Suddenly, their movie star sister, Masha, swoops in with her new boy toy, Spike. Old resentments flare up, eventually leading to threats to sell the house.
